DestaqueCases de SucessoSlider

Inovações Em Frameworks Para Criar Sites Mais Rápidos

Inovações em frameworks estão revolucionando a forma como criamos sites. Descubra as últimas tendências e ferramentas que garantem maior velocidade e eficiência na web no artigo de hoje do blog 3T DEV.

Novas tecnologias para impulsionar a velocidade dos websites: frameworks inovadores em foco

Novas tecnologias para impulsionar a velocidade dos websites: frameworks inovadores em foco no contexto de Desenvolvimento web.

Implementação de Lazy Loading

O que é lazy loading?
Lazy loading é uma técnica utilizada para carregar conteúdos de forma assíncrona, ou seja, apenas quando são necessários. Isso contribui para acelerar o carregamento da página, pois os elementos são carregados conforme o usuário vai rolando a página e precisando deles.

Como isso impacta na velocidade do site?
A implementação de lazy loading em frameworks para desenvolvimento web ajuda a reduzir o tempo de carregamento inicial da página, já que os elementos mais pesados, como imagens ou vídeos, só serão carregados à medida que forem visualizados pelo usuário. Isso proporciona uma experiência de navegação mais rápida e eficiente.

Otimização de Código e Recursos

Qual a importância da otimização de código e recursos?
A otimização de código e recursos é essencial para garantir um site mais rápido. Isso inclui minificar arquivos CSS e JavaScript, comprimir imagens, utilizar CDN (Content Delivery Network) e outras práticas que visam reduzir o tamanho dos arquivos e melhorar o tempo de carregamento.

Como os frameworks estão incorporando essa otimização?
Os frameworks mais modernos estão cada vez mais focados em oferecer ferramentas e funcionalidades que facilitam a otimização de código e recursos. Por meio de plugins, pacotes e configurações específicas, os desenvolvedores podem automatizar grande parte desse processo, tornando mais simples e eficiente a criação de sites rápidos e responsivos.

Utilização de Server-Side Rendering e Client-Side Rendering

O que significa Server-Side Rendering e Client-Side Rendering?
Server-Side Rendering (SSR) é a prática de renderizar a interface do usuário no servidor antes de enviá-la ao navegador, enquanto o Client-Side Rendering (CSR) faz essa renderização no lado do cliente, ou seja, no navegador do usuário.

Como essas técnicas podem melhorar a performance de um site?
A combinação de Server-Side Rendering e Client-Side Rendering pode contribuir para um carregamento mais rápido das páginas. O SSR inicial permite que as páginas sejam entregues com conteúdo já renderizado, enquanto o CSR posterior mantém a interatividade e dinamismo. Dessa forma, a experiência do usuário é aprimorada, evitando tempos de carregamento excessivos.

Duvidas Frequentes

Quais são os frameworks mais inovadores atualmente para otimizar a velocidade de carregamento de sites no desenvolvimento web?

Os frameworks mais inovadores atualmente para otimizar a velocidade de carregamento de sites no desenvolvimento web são o React e o Next.js.

Como as novas tecnologias e abordagens em frameworks estão contribuindo para a criação de sites mais rápidos e eficientes?

As novas tecnologias e abordagens em frameworks estão contribuindo para a criação de sites mais rápidos e eficientes ao oferecerem otimizações de desempenho e processos automatizados que melhoram a performance e a eficiência no desenvolvimento de páginas web.

Quais são as práticas recomendadas no uso de frameworks para garantir um alto desempenho na velocidade de carregamento de sites no desenvolvimento web?

Minificar e combinar arquivos, otimizar imagens, utilizar CDN e caching são práticas recomendadas para garantir um alto desempenho na velocidade de carregamento de sites ao utilizar frameworks no desenvolvimento web.